Direct Answer: Why Is Being the “Go-To Person” a Problem?
Because it centralizes decisions and slows execution.
When execution pauses without you,
progress slows down.
Why Helping Too Much Backfires
It feels responsible to stay involved.
But the pattern creates unintended consequences:
- Delayed decision-making
- Lower accountability
- Increased dependency

Definition: What Is a Leadership Bottleneck?
It’s a structural constraint created by over-centralized leadership.
